Here is her honest review of the box, as tested by Lezley and Ava (age very nearly 4).

Ava chose the coaster to make first she needed adult help to cut the foam but then enjoyed peeling off the backing and sticking it onto the card. Ava made two coasters from the resources included in the pack. The activity lasted around 30-45 mins.
Ava did enjoy this activity.



Ava loved making the parrot but didn't want to paint the tube but wanted to use the glue again so we used the coloured paper to cover the tube. This activity was easy for Ava to do and she carefully choose what colour feathers she wanted where on the parrot.


The prints were more difficult as it needed an adult to cut the string as Ava chose the sun shape as her print.  She lost concentration waiting for the glue to dry on the print before using it but then enjoyed dipping it in the paint and making pictures of the sun. Maybe a little more string would have been useful to make another design but we cut a potato up and made potato prints with the left over paint.


All in all Ava does enjoy the box activities and likes to stick her well earned stickers onto the instruction cards.
